Transaction 
Identifier  
The transaction identifier identifies the command packet and reply packet with a 
unique number. The transaction identifier in the reply packet is copied from the 
command packet and returned in this field, so that the command and the 
corresponding reply have the same transaction identifier value. 
Header 
CRC  
The header CRC used to detect errors in the header part of the command 
packet. See section 7.6.7 for CRC generation.
